Evaluate Rates and Solutions
Comprehending the various pricing structures and services available from moving companies is important for an well-informed decision. Prospective customers ought to compare flat-rate and hourly pricing models, along with any additional fees that may be applicable, like fuel surcharges or packing services. Ensuring to evaluate the included services, like loading, unloading, and storage options, is important. Certain companies might provide specialized services, such as piano moving or packing supplies, which could change total costs. Obtaining several quotes and assessing what every package entails helps individuals identify the best value for their particular needs. In the end, effective communication with moving companies regarding expectations and needs will aid in choosing the appropriate service for a seamless relocation.

Important Concerns for Your Mover?
When selecting a moving company, what crucial inquiries should one ask to ensure a smooth relocation? First, inquire about the company's knowledge and skills in managing moves similar to yours. This helps establish their reliability. Next, ask about their pricing structure, including whether quotes are fixed or flexible. Recognizing potential hidden fees is vital for budgeting.
In addition, it is advisable to question their policies on unloading, packing, and loading. Recognizing the level of support and offerings offered can benefit in strategizing. One should also review the mover's insurance coverage, ensuring suitable security for precious items during delivery.
Finally, inquire about the anticipated schedule for the move and any necessary preparations needed in advance. These inquiries will provide clarity and confidence in the chosen mover, significantly reducing relocation stress.

How Much Ought I to Tip My Movers?
A tip of 15-20% of the entire moving expense is typically appropriate for movers. For exceptional service, some individuals choose to tip more, while others might opt for a fixed sum, usually $20-$50 per mover.
Which Products Do Movers Typically Not Transport?
Movers typically do not carry dangerous goods, perishable goods, vegetation, pets, precious belongings such as jewelry, and important documents. Clients should confirm specific restrictions with their relocation service to guarantee compliance and prevent issues during relocation.
